Возможный дубликат:
Как использовать DNS для перенаправления домена на определенный порт на моем сервере
Я развернул веб-сайт интрасети нашей компании на сервере IIS 7 и добавил следующую информацию о привязке
IP-адрес: все неназначенные
порт: 3333
имя домена: subdomain_name.domain_name.com
Я также добавил запись в DNS. Я могу пропинговать полное доменное имя, но когда я бросаю его в браузер, я получаю 404.
Когда сайт развернут под 80 портом, он работает нормально. Однако это не работает, если мой сайт размещен на чем-либо, кроме порта по умолчанию (80).
Есть ли способ сделать это? Я хочу получить доступ к моему сайту, развернутому на порту 3333, как показано ниже: subdomain.domain.com
Вы должны получить к нему доступ так:
subdomain.domain.com:3333
Кроме того, вы можете настроить псевдоним на контроллере домена для доступа к нему по более удобному URL-адресу, избавив коллег от необходимости запоминать номера портов и тому подобное.
Обратите внимание, что это, скорее всего, принадлежит сайту Server Fault Stack Exchange, я проголосовал за перенос его туда для вашей же выгоды, поскольку этот сайт посвящен таким темам, и вы должны получить преимущество гораздо большего опыта и знаний, чем я, возможно надеюсь предоставить.
Пожалуйста, простите за некорректную терминологию по поводу серверов.
Вы не можете сделать это с помощью DNS или перенаправления заголовка хоста. Для этого вам необходимо перезаписать URL-адрес. Взгляните на Модуль перезаписи URL.